About agriculture in Ouedallah

Ouedallah is located in the Woroba region of Côte d’Ivoire, a district characterized by its rolling savanna landscapes interspersed with patches of denser woodland. The surrounding rural area is shaped by the transition between the forest and savanna zones, offering a varied topography that supports both traditional settlements and expansive agricultural plots.

The region is primarily centered around subsistence and commercial farming, with a focus on rain-fed agriculture. Common crops include cashews and cocoa, which are major drivers of the local economy, alongside food staples such as yams, maize, and cassava. Livestock rearing, particularly cattle and small ruminants, also plays a vital role in the rural livelihood of the district.
